Rep. Davis Bill Recognizing 1908 Springfield Race Riot Site Gets Hearing
October 29, 2019
WASHINGTON, Oct. 29 -- Rep. Rodney Davis, R-Illinois, issued the following news release:

U.S. Rep. Rodney Davis (R-Ill.) today testified before the House Natural Resources Committee subcommittee hearing on the importance of his bill to make the site of the 1908 Springfield Race Riots a national monument. The hearing follows Davis' announcement last month that the U.S. Department of Interior (DOI) recently found the site to be suitable for designation as a National Historic Monument. . . .
